The Canadian Pacific Railway ( French: Chemin de fer Canadien Pacifique) ( reporting marks CP, CPAA, MILW, SOO ), also known simply as CPR or Canadian Pacific and formerly as CP Rail (1968–1996), was a Canadian Class I railway incorporated in 1881. Canadian National Railway's diesel fuel consumption 2013-2022; Canadian National Railway's average fuel cost 2013-2022; U.S. Class I railroads - miles of operated freight railroad 2015;Canadian National Railway Company, incorporated 6 June 1919, is the longest railway system in North America, controlling more than 31,000 km of track in Canada and the United States. Track gauge. 4 ft 8. +. 1⁄2 in ( 1,435 mm) standard gauge. The National Transcontinental Railway ( NTR) was a historic railway between Winnipeg and Moncton in Canada. Much of the line is now operated by the Canadian National Railway .
